Which is cheaper, Ivy Tech Community College or Indiana State University?
Ivy Tech Community College is the more affordable option at roughly $4,912, compared to $9,992. Factor in residency status, financial aid, and program length when deciding — total cost matters more than annual tuition.

How do I decide between Ivy Tech Community College and Indiana State University?
Start by ruling out programs you can't get into (compare your GPA against each school's admissions stats), then weight what matters most — NCLEX pass rate for quality, total tuition for cost, length for time-to-degree, and format (online, hybrid, in-person) for lifestyle.
